Salem – Judy A. Schnaderbeck, 67, formerly of Salem, passed away Wednesday morning, September 9, 2015 at the Washington Center in Argyle.
[private]Born January 21, 1948 in Troy, NY, she was the daughter of the late Edward Orville and Emma (Weaver) Michaels.
Judy was a 1967 graduate on Berlin Central School and attended business school in Schenectady.
She was a homemaker and enjoyed knitting, crocheting, puzzles and needlework.
Judy was married to Edwin H. Schnaderbeck on October 18, 1969, he passed away December 28, 1977.
She is survived by her two children, Michael Schnaderbeck of Salem and Shining Star Schnaderbeck of Texas; a sister, Saralyn Hurley of Belcher; a brother, Bruce Michaels of Petersburgh. She is also survived by four grandchildren, Chandra Winchell, Autumn Chamberlin, Montana Schnaderbeck and Malachi Schnaderbeck.
